Structural Strength & Integrity

From engineers to installation representatives, they will sing the praises of a corkjoint system in the context of providing strength and integrity to a site. The top items in this market will offer a multipurpose sealant design that is elastic by nature but resistant to high chemical components like fuels and oils that denigrate the surface and erode the foundations. That degree of strength lays the foundation for a home, office or warehouse that needs to be durable to survive the elements.

Applied to Different Surfaces

A key selling point for adopting these systems is because it can be applied to a range of porous surfaces. This will include limestone, natural stone, concrete and brick surfaces, offering an adaptable sealant that works for almost any kind of residential or commercial setting.
